Details
-
Sub-task
-
Status: Resolved
-
Major
-
Resolution: Duplicate
-
3.0.0-alpha1
-
None
-
None
Description
Currently du command output:
[ ~]$ hdfs dfs -du -h /home/rgao/ 0 /home/rgao/.Trash 0 /home/rgao/.staging 100 M /home/rgao/ds 250 M /home/rgao/ds-2 200 M /home/rgao/noECBackup-ds 500 M /home/rgao/noECBackup-ds-2
For hdfs users and administrators, EC policy and storage policy related usage summarization would be very helpful when managing storages of cluster. The imitate output of du could be like the following.
[ ~]$ hdfs dfs -du -h -t( total, parameter to be added) /home/rgao 0 /home/rgao/.Trash 0 /home/rgao/.staging [Archive] [EC:RS-DEFAULT-6-3-64k] 100 M /home/rgao/ds [DISK] [EC:RS-DEFAULT-6-3-64k] 250 M /home/rgao/ds-2 [DISK] [Replica] 200 M /home/rgao/noECBackup-ds [DISK] [Replica] 500 M /home/rgao/noECBackup-ds-2 Total: [Archive][EC:RS-DEFAULT-6-3-64k] 100 M [Archive][Replica] 0 M [DISK] [EC:RS-DEFAULT-6-3-64k] 250 M [DISK] [Replica] 700 M [Archive][ALL] 100M [DISK] [ALL] 950M [ALL] [EC:RS-DEFAULT-6-3-64k] 350M [ALL] [Replica] 700M